What is the point of pruney fingers?


I have never known exactly why our fingers get pruney when they get wet.  Well, scientists think this is an evolutionary adaptation that evolved from primates to help us grip things when they are wet.  They compare this phenomenon to the treads on tires, and how they help the tires keep traction when the roads are wet.
